Science Teacher job summary
Hartsdown Academy, as part of the Coastal Academies Trust, proudly serves the Thanet community through providing an amazing education for its children. We do this by ensuring each student has a high quality curriculum that meets the demands of creating lifelong learners, global citizens and that reflects the needs of our local context. In delivering this curriculum, we take an evidenced based approach to teaching, learning and assessment that fosters a culture of learning and achievement for both students and staff. To work at Hartsdown is to be part of a dedicated and passionate team of skilled professionals that collaborate together to ensure that each and every child receives a first class education that leads onto a bright and successful future.
This is an excellent opportunity for the successful candidate to develop in this role with the possibility of taking on the 2nd in Charge of Science role or an experienced Science teacher to take on this role straight away with an added TLR.
Join us on our exciting journey from being a good school to a great school.
The ideal candidate will have high expectations of young people and want to progress in their career. They will have a commitment to ensuring that children can achieve their full educational potential. They will hold positive values and attitudes and adopt high standards of behaviour in their professional role.

Help children make their dreams reality and put an end to wasted potential. A child from a disadvantaged background is much less likely to get good GCSES and go on to higher education. The impact of this lasts a lifetime. The number of children in poverty continues to increase and Thanet is one of the poorest areas in the UK.
Hartsdown refuses to accept that a child’s past and circumstances define their future and are looking for people who are committed to ensuring that every child has an education that gives them an amazing life.
We believe:
• that education is the key to a successful and fulfilled life
• that success is determined by effort and character
• that education is more than exams it is about supporting children to be curious and internationally minded citizen who love learning and want to improve the world
• that a great school changes lives
It is hard work at Hartsdown but you become part of a team that is committed to changing the world, one child at a time.
